Russian Foreign Ministry Spokesperson Maria Zakharova has held a news conference.
Report informs, citing RIA Novosti, that Zakharova spoke about the current situation in Afghanistan.
Touching upon the dialogue between the Taliban grouping and other political powers, including former President Hamid Karzai, Zakharova stressed that it is a topic of interest for Russia in many aspects.
"This issue is a topic of interest for Russia in terms of Afghanistan's future state establishment, citizens' interests, women's rights, and several other aspects," she said.
